​About the book The Bankerupt

The Bankerupt by Ravi Subramanian is a thrilling ride into the world of banking, corruption, and high-stakes financial games. Subramanian, with his rich background in the banking industry, gives readers an inside look at the complexities of the financial world, blending suspense and real-life issues with his characteristic narrative style. The story revolves around a young, ambitious banker named Harsh. He is working in a prestigious multinational bank and is determined to climb the corporate ladder, no matter the cost. Harsh's life seems set on a promising path until he stumbles upon a scandal that could bring down not just his career but the entire financial system. When a series of shady transactions come to light, Harsh finds himself in the middle of a conspiracy involving corrupt politicians, high-ranking officials, and even some of his own colleagues. As Harsh digs deeper into the mystery, he is forced to confront the harsh realities of the banking world, where ethical lines are often blurred for personal gain. The story moves quickly between boardrooms, secret meetings, and international dealings, showing how greed, power, and betrayal shape the lives of those in control of financial institutions. Harsh’s struggle is both personal and professional, as he tries to balance his desire for success with his moral compass. The key theme of The Bankerupt is the tension between ambition and ethics. The book explores how people in positions of power can easily get lost in the pursuit of money and influence. Harsh’s journey is a reflection of how a seemingly innocent desire to succeed can lead to morally compromising situations, and how difficult it is to choose the right path when there’s so much at stake. The plot keeps you hooked with its twists and turns, making you question who can truly be trusted in the cutthroat world of finance. The suspense builds up as Harsh uncovers more about the high-level corruption that runs deep within the banking industry. Each revelation pulls him deeper into a web of lies, where the stakes are no longer just financial but personal as well. Subramanian’s writing makes complex financial jargon easy to understand, allowing the reader to follow the twists in the plot without getting lost. His characters are well-developed, each representing a different facet of the corporate world, from the ruthless to the idealistic, making the story both engaging and thought-provoking.
